Mutual - definition of mutual by The Free Dictionary
usage: The earliest (15th century) meaning of mutual is “reciprocal”: Teachers and students sometimes suffer from mutual misunderstanding. By the 16th century mutual had developed the additional sense “held in common, shared”: Their mutual objective is peace.
MUTUAL definition and meaning | Collins English Dictionary
You use mutual to describe a situation, feeling, or action that is experienced, felt, or done by both of two people mentioned. The East and the West can work together for their mutual benefit and progress. It's plain that he adores his daughter, and the feeling is mutual.
